Abstract EN
A class of Cohen-Grossberg-type BAM neural networks with distributed delays and impulses are investigated in this paper.
Sufficient conditions to guarantee the uniqueness and global exponential stability of the periodic solutions of such networks are established by using suitable Lyapunov function, the properties of M-matrix, and some suitable mathematical transformation.
The results in this paper improve the earlier publications.
